Transaction 73588207fb914e76d0f6af69b28b7e5d5f1eb90dfe333986590a22a1ad7a8226

block
bd3dd404e24153a94232fee5906edc19f7c79baf5b2409d4bb7a538cbec26fb9

1 Input

2 Outputs